1 If one root of the quadratic equation 2px^2 - 10px - 3 = 0 is alpha, and the other root is one more than alpha, what is the other root?
  • A alpha - 1
  • B alpha + 1
  • C alpha^2
  • D 1/alpha
2 For the quadratic equation ax^2 + bx + c = 0, what is the sum of the roots?
  • A -b/a
  • B b/a
  • C c/a
  • D -c/a
3 For the quadratic equation ax^2 + bx + c = 0, what is the product of the roots?
  • A -b/a
  • B b/a
  • C c/a
  • D -c/a
4 In the equation 2px^2 - 10px - 3 = 0, what is the sum of the roots in terms of p?
  • A 5
  • B 10p
  • C 5/p
  • D -5
5 In the equation 2px^2 - 10px - 3 = 0, what is the product of the roots in terms of p?
  • A 3/2p
  • B -3/2p
  • C -3/p
  • D 3/p
